zoukankan      html  css  js  c++  java
  • Main方法

            Main方法是程序的入口点。程序从这里开始,也是从这里结束。程序在执行编写的源代码时,是先找Main方法,然后开始执行Main方法中“(”开始后的第一句代码,依次执行,如果遇到Main方法中有调用其他的方法时,便会根据名称找到定义方法的代码,然后依次执行这个方法内的代码,执行完这个方法后,再返回到Main方法继续执行,直到遇到Main方法的结束符“)”,执行程序结束。

            C#程序的入口类似C和C++程序的main()函数,区别在于C#的这个方法必须是一个类的静态成员。Main方法可以是void类型或返回类型是int,并可以接受字符串数组形式的命令参数,其形式有:

    (1)public static void Main();  //无参数无返回值

    (2)public static int Main();  //无参数有返回值

    (3)public static void Main(string[] args);  //有参数无返回值,编译器一般默认创建此方法

    (4)public static int Main(string[] args);  //有参数有返回值

            在一个程序中,Main方法只能有一个,并且该方法的位置不必固定,C#编译器找到Main方法,并将其作为这个程序的入口。如果一个程序集中存在多个Main方法,可以使用/main开关来指定应该使用哪个方法,或者指定另一个方法作为程序的入口。

  • 相关阅读:
    JQuery上传插件Uploadify使用详解
    jquery easyui datagrid使用参考
    easyui datagrid使用(好)
    灵活运用 SQL SERVER FOR XML PATH
    C# HttpRequest 中文编码问题
    echarts简单使用
    [bootstrap] 修改字体
    css :not 选择器
    [win7] 带网络的安全模式,启动QQEIMPlatform第三方服务
    [mysql] 添加用户,赋予不同的管理权限
  • 原文地址:https://www.cnblogs.com/hachi/p/1981764.html
Copyright © 2011-2022 走看看